Transaction 833f717bb95cc3bee623afee4298a66bf57678eb38ef0e7f8047a5bf80010482

1 Input
2 Outputs
  • 833f717bb95cc3bee623afee4298a66bf57678eb38ef0e7f8047a5bf80010482:0
  • value  4000000
    address  32vgaJEa8cAU9kNRZorjChng8zLC7VSvf1
  • 833f717bb95cc3bee623afee4298a66bf57678eb38ef0e7f8047a5bf80010482:1
  • value  13493673
    address  1HrCXZzKifVwfH5EN61ahRtbMcrqXD2ayp